  • Ultimate Marvel vs Capcom 3: The expanded version of 2011’s MvC3, featuring rebalanced gameplay and 12 additional characters. This is the definitive edition.
  • ROM (Read-Only Memory): In console terms, a ROM file is a digital dump of a game disc. For Xbox 360, these come as .iso (disc image), .god (Games on Demand), or extracted folder structures.
  • Xbox 360: The specific console architecture (PowerPC-based). Emulating it requires significantly more horsepower than PS2 or SNES emulation.
